# Ostenwald read-replica lag alarm — env configuration
# Reviewer notes: the alarm polls replica heartbeat rows every 10s and fires
# when measured lag exceeds LAG_THRESHOLD_MS for three consecutive polls.
# Debounce is intentional; single spikes during checkpoint flushes are normal.
# Alarm state transitions are written to the Calverly events topic, never
# acted on directly here. Publishing to that topic requires authentication,
# and the credential is defined on the next line:

secret setting of yafof-tawep: RELAY_SECRET8=8abb5772

Handover note — Crumbwheel order cutoffs.

Welcome aboard. The bakery cutoff rule in Crumbwheel closes same-day orders at 14:00 local to each storefront, not UTC — this has bitten us twice. Holiday overrides live in the calendar service and take precedence silently, so always check there first when a cutoff looks wrong. To unlock the calendar service's admin console after a restart, enter the recovery passphrase below.

vault phrase of bagap-bahaf = silion-pelox-sorox-casdor-quenwyn-fraax-eliox-praael-kelion-quenvan-kasox-rusael-norius-belvan

Subject: Validator plugins — what you need to know for on-call

Hi, and welcome to the rotation. Most tickets this quarter involve the Sievewright plugin system, which lets teams drop custom data validators into the ingest pipeline. If a validator misbehaves, disable it via the registry rather than restarting the pipeline; restarts reload all plugins and can mask the culprit. Each plugin logs under its own namespace, so filter before digging in. The disable procedure and plugin registry live on this page:

wiki page, fajof-tajef: https://vault.tolvaqio.corp/board/pipeline/pages/ticket/c20d7f984bcc9e12

# Break-Glass: Catalog Cache Invalidation

Scope: the Pinrow product catalog at Veldstone Retail. If stale prices persist after a purge and the Hollowmere invalidation queue is wedged, use break-glass to flush the edge tier directly. Contractors: get verbal sign-off from the catalog lead first. Steps: open the Hollowmere admin shell, select emergency-flush, confirm the tenant, and run it once — repeated flushes thrash the origin. Access is logged and expires after 20 minutes. Unseal the admin shell with the passphrase below.

recovery phrase for kahop-tajog: istix-casvan